      Meaning of the first name
      Vi

      Origin 
      American

      Meaning 
      Violet

      Variations 
      Via, Vic, Vin

      *Some content has been generated by an artificial intelligence language model, in combination with data sourced from Ancestry records and provided by BabyNames.com.
      The name Vi, derived from the American culture, has its roots in the word 'Violet.' The word Violet, originating from the Latin 'viola,' has been used as a given name for centuries. This name was first associated with the flower, which holds various symbolic meanings, including modesty, innocence, and faithfulness. As time progressed, Violet gained popularity as a name for girls and eventually gave rise to the shortened form Vi.
